The Allure of French Door Handles: A Comprehensive Guide
French doors have long been a sign of beauty and elegance in domestic style. Their large panes of glass permit sufficient natural light and a seamless shift between indoor and outdoor spaces. However, the appeal of French Door Contractors doors is not simply in their structure; it's also in the details. One crucial element that can elevate the overall aesthetic is the option of door handles. This short article explores the various types, products, and designs of French door handles, directing house owners in making notified decisions.

Understanding French Door Handles
Before delving into the specifics, it's necessary to understand what French door handles are. These handles are designed particularly for French doors, which generally include two hinged doors that swing open. Unlike standard door handles, French door handles must consider the unique mechanics of double doors, ensuring both performance and aesthetic appeal.
Table 1: Types of French Door Handles
| Deal with Type | Description | Best Suited For |
|---|---|---|
| Lever Handles | A basic lever that is easy to use. | Modern and minimalist styles. |
| Knob Handles | A standard round knob, readily available in different sizes. | Timeless and classic styles. |
| Locking Handles | These included built-in locks for security. | Residences needing extra security. |
| Pull Handles | Long handles that are understood to pull doors open. | Pairs well with Sliding French Door Repairs French doors. |
| Thumb Latch | A latch that can be operated with a thumb, frequently on the exterior. | Rustic or country-style homes. |
Materials Matter
The material of the door handle considerably impacts its toughness, appearance, and maintenance requirements. Here are some popular products used in French door handles:
Table 2: Common Materials for French Door Handles
| Product | Benefits | Drawbacks |
|---|---|---|
| Stainless-steel | High resistance to corrosion and rust. | Can be cold to touch in winter. |
| Brass | Timeless look, develops a special patina. | Can taint over time. |
| Bronze | Strong and durable, with an abundant finish. | Heavier than other materials. |
| Aluminum | Light-weight and resistant to rust. | May lack the beauty of heavier metals. |
| Plastic | Affordable and readily available in different colors. | Less resilient and might not fit high end designs. |
House owners ought to consider their home's architectural style, environment, and personal choices when choosing the best material.
Designs and Aesthetics
French door handles come in a myriad of designs to complement any design. From rustic to modern, the handle design can drastically transform the appearance of the doors and the whole room.
List of Popular Styles
- Conventional: Often made of brass or bronze, these handles boast elaborate styles and typically feature a patina finish.
- Contemporary: Sleek and minimalist, these handles are normally made from stainless-steel or brushed nickel, emphasizing simplicity without ornate information.
- Rustic: Features a distressed or weathered look, often made from wrought iron or aged brass, ideal for country-style homes.
- Art Deco: Characterized by geometric shapes and vibrant curves, often found in distinct surfaces like increased gold or matte black.
- Vintage: Replicas or refinished antique handles add character and fond memories to an area.
Installation Considerations
While some homeowners may choose to set up French door handles themselves, it's worth noting that appropriate installation is crucial for both visual appeal and functionality.
Key Installation Tips
- Measure Carefully: Ensure that the deal with is at the proper height and aligns with the other door's handle.
- Look for Alignment: Both doors ought to line up completely when near avoid spaces or misalignment.
- Use Quality Screws: Using screws that match the deal with material assists keep the look and longevity of the installation.
- Consult a Professional: If unsure about the installation process, working with a carpenter or handyman might save time and ensure a professional finish.
Frequently Asked Questions About French Door Handles
Q: How do I select the ideal handle for my French doors?
A: Consider the style of your home, the functionality you require, and the product that best fits your aesthetic and maintenance choices.
Q: Can I use standard door handles on French doors?
A: While it's possible, it's generally advised to utilize handles developed specifically for French doors to make sure proper operation and aesthetic harmony.
Q: Do I require a locking system on my French door handles?
A: If security is an issue, particularly for ground-level doors, it's wise to select handles with built-in locking systems.
Q: How do I keep my French door handles?
A: Maintenance will depend upon the material. Normally, regular cleansing with a soft fabric and periodic polishing (for metal handles) will keep them looking new.
Q: Are there any environmentally friendly choices offered?
A: Yes, many producers now offer handles made from sustainable materials or recycled metals, interesting ecologically mindful homeowners.
